A barely
conscious Kabir Maharjan floated in a dark, muddy pool inside a pitch-black
passage for nine days, trapped beneath the wreckage of Nepal’s worst flood
disaster in decades.
When he awoke
at a hospital following a miracle rescue, his clouded mind failed to recognize
his own wife, leaving him to ask why she had delayed in giving him a bed.
